如何在没有数据库的虚拟主机上搭建网站? (虚拟主机没有数据库)
- 行业动态
- 2024-02-22
- 2
在没有数据库的虚拟主机上搭建网站,可以选择使用诸如WordPress,Joomla!,Drupal等流行的网站平台。这些平台的优势在于易于使用且功能强大。你需要在这些平台中选择一个合适的网站程序,然后注册一个虚拟主机。虚拟主机可以看作是一个准备好的网站空间,建站需要的一切都由服务商提供和维护,包括服务器硬盘、内存等资源。这种方式省心且上手快,节约了建站成本和时间。虽然共享IP和硬件资源可能会受到邻居的影响,但总体来说,这是对没有技术背景的用户来说非常友好的解决方案。
在没有数据库的虚拟主机上搭建网站,虽然可能会遇到一些限制,但仍然可以通过一些方法实现,以下是一些可能的解决方案:
1、使用静态网页:静态网页是最基本的网页形式,它们不依赖于数据库,而是直接将内容嵌入到HTML文件中,这种方法的优点是简单易行,不需要任何额外的技术知识,它的缺点是无法实现用户交互和动态内容更新。
2、使用文件系统:你可以在虚拟主机的文件系统中创建一个文件夹,将所有的网站文件(如HTML、CSS、JavaScript等)存储在这个文件夹中,你可以通过修改URL来访问这些文件,这种方法的优点是简单易行,不需要任何额外的技术知识,它的缺点是无法实现用户交互和动态内容更新。
3、使用服务器端脚本语言:如果你熟悉某种服务器端脚本语言(如PHP、Python等),你可以使用这种语言来生成动态内容,这种方法的优点是可以实现用户交互和动态内容更新,但是需要一定的编程知识。
4、使用第三方服务:有一些第三方服务(如GitHub Pages、Netlify等)允许你在没有数据库的情况下搭建网站,这些服务通常会提供一个URL,你只需要将你的网站文件上传到这个URL,就可以通过这个URL访问你的网站了,这种方法的优点是简单易行,不需要任何额外的技术知识,但是可能需要支付一定的费用。
5、使用云存储服务:有一些云存储服务(如Amazon S3、Google Cloud Storage等)提供了静态网站托管功能,你可以将你的网站文件上传到这些服务,然后通过这些服务提供的URL访问你的网站,这种方法的优点是可以实现用户交互和动态内容更新,但是需要一定的编程知识。
6、使用CDN服务:有一些CDN服务(如Cloudflare、Akamai等)提供了静态网站托管功能,你可以将你的网站文件上传到这些服务,然后通过这些服务提供的URL访问你的网站,这种方法的优点是可以实现用户交互和动态内容更新,但是需要一定的编程知识。
虽然没有数据库的虚拟主机可能会带来一些限制,但是通过上述方法,你仍然可以在这种环境下搭建网站。
相关问题与解答:
1、Q: 我可以使用什么工具来创建静态网页?
A: 你可以使用任何文本编辑器来创建静态网页,如Notepad++、Sublime Text等,你也可以使用一些专门的网页编辑器,如Visual Studio Code、Atom等。
2、Q: 我可以使用什么语言来生成动态内容?
A: 你可以使用任何服务器端脚本语言来生成动态内容,如PHP、Python、Ruby等,你需要在你的虚拟主机上安装相应的服务器软件,并学习相应的编程语言。
3、Q: 我可以使用哪些第三方服务来搭建网站?
A: 你可以使用GitHub Pages、Netlify、Vercel等第三方服务来搭建网站,这些服务通常会提供一个URL,你只需要将你的网站文件上传到这个URL,就可以通过这个URL访问你的网站了。
4、Q: 我可以使用哪些云存储服务来托管我的网站?
A: 你可以使用Amazon S3、Google Cloud Storage、Microsoft Azure Blob Storage等云存储服务来托管你的网站,你需要将这些服务配置为静态网站托管,然后将你的网站文件上传到这些服务。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/228770.html